Your support of YWCA Toronto goes directly to our 30-plus programs and services which help women and girls escape violence and rebuild healthy lives, while offering a range of housing options, employment and skills development, as well as girls’ and family programs throughout the city. YWCA Toronto is a Turning Point in the lives of women and girls. We are the city's only multi-service organization by, for and about women and girls. We welcome women of all faiths, sexual orientations, races, cultural affiliations and creeds. YWCA has been there for just over 130 years, supporting women and girls who want to make change.
We are there when women and girls need shelter, employment skills, counselling, permanent housing, or the confidence that comes from outdoor education and leadership training. We are also there speaking out when a public policy needs changing, or a regulation has a negative impact, or when the progress of achieving true equality for women and girls is stalled, on the wrong track or no longer a priority in public life. We are the leading publisher of the Life Skills training manuals, and the proud host of the annual Women of Distinction fundraising awards dinner. This year we were the turning point in the lives of over 26,000 across the GTA. As part of a national and international movement, the YWCA is a force in the lives of 25 million women and girls world wide. YWCA is an Association and a movement that is in a period of renewal. In the past 5 years, we have increased our visibility as a voice for women, expanded the number or participants we serve by more than 50%, established more programs in the city’s most underserved neighbourhoods and now work with nearly 140% more young women and girls.
